Cost of Barn Foundation Repair in Helena
The cost of barn foundation repair in Helena, MT can vary significantly based on several factors. This guide will help you understand what influences these costs and provide a general idea of what you might expect to pay for common repair tasks.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Barn Size: Larger barns typically require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Foundation Type: The type of foundation (e.g., concrete slab, pier and beam) can affect the complexity and cost of repairs.
- Extent of Damage: Minor cracks are less expensive to fix than major structural issues.
- Soil Conditions: Poor soil conditions may necessitate additional stabilization measures, increasing costs.
- Accessibility: Difficult-to-access areas can require more labor and specialized equipment.
- Local Labor Rates: Labor costs in Helena, MT can vary, influencing the total repair cost.
- Permits and Inspections: Required permits and inspections can add to the overall expense.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ost (Helena, MT) |
---|---|
Crack Repair | $500 - $1,500 |
Foundation Pier Installation | $1,000 - $3,000 per pier |
Slab Jacking | $2,000 - $7,000 |
Waterproofing | $1,500 - $5,000 |
Structural Reinforcement | $3,000 - $10,000 |
Soil Stabilization | $2,500 - $8,000 |
Full Foundation Replacement | $20,000 - $50,000 |
